Originally posted by mike
I'm with Alex*D and ChrisL.
Is your bike mechanic reliable/trust-able? Look at your sprocket teeth. Do they look like shark fins or are they really pointy instead of flat topped? This is the sign of worn sprockets.


We can guess that only one or two sprockets on your cluster are worn. You should be able to replace these sprockets rather than replacing the whole freewheel/cassette.
